Teachers used tables to build a bridge for students to enter a flooded school for their exams in eastern China.

In the video, filmed in the city of Huai'an in Jiangsu Province on June 15, students walked on top of the 'table bridge' to get into the school one-by-one for the high school entrance exams. 1500 students entered the exam centre at Jiangsu Zhengliangmei Senior High School successfully, reports said.
